Stop Saying “Use a Travel Agent”: The Language That’s Killing Your Value
In this episode of the No BS Travel Advisor Podcast, Marcie Muensterman breaks down how phrases like “use a travel agent,” “I’m free,” and “agents should be free” quietly undermine the entire travel advisor industry. Using a powerful softball-life lesson about identity and mistakes, Marcie connects brain chemistry, confidence, and marketing language, then calls out the “free to use” messaging that attracts tire-kickers, ghosters, and bargain behavior. This is not a fee episode, it’s a positioning episode. Marcie shares her own history as a destination wedding specialist who did most weddings without charging, explains how “free” language contributed to burnout, and gives a simple script shift: hire me / partner with me / work with me.

Key Talking Points:
- You are not defined by mistakes (softball lesson → business confidence)
- Language changes how you perceive yourself and how prospects perceive you
- “Free” doesn’t communicate value; it communicates scarcity and desperation
- “Use” is commodity language. Professionals get hired, not used
- “Free to use” = magnet for tire kickers, ghosters, and endless quoting
- You don’t get paid until clients book + travel (so “free” is factually misleading in practice)
- You can position professionally even if you don’t charge a fee
- Industry reality: fee-charging is common and normalized publicly in the industry press and org messaging (but this episode isn’t about forcing fees)
Stats / Sources Mentioned:
- Host Agency Reviews: At least 50% of advisors who are hosted charge fees.
- Host Agency Reviews: 75% of independent advisors reported charging fees (2020 independent fee report): https://hostagencyreviews.com/
- ASTA acknowledges that upwards of 72% of advisors charge professional fees: https://www.asta.org/Common/Uploaded%20files/ASTA/2025-astapresskit.pdf / https://www.travelagewest.com/Industry-Insight/Business-Features/asta-travel-agent-fees
- Travel Weekly summary of a WTAAA report: 55% of agencies charge fees and Travel Weekly’s 2024 survey found 44% overall charge fees: https://www.travelweekly.com/Travel-News/Travel-Agent-Issues/Survey-shows-that-travel-advisors-have-lots-of-new-clients
